What is a Short Sale?
A short sale occurs when a homeowner sells their property for an amount that is less than the outstanding mortgage balance, with the lender consenting to accept the reduced sum. This option is frequently utilized to prevent foreclosure and provides buyers with opportunities to purchase short sale properties at prices that are often lower than standard market rates.
In contrast to traditional sales, a short sale necessitates lender approval, extensive documentation, and typically requires greater patience. Therefore, it is essential to collaborate with a realtor who is certified in short sales and possesses the expertise to navigate bank interactions, timelines, and negotiations effectively.

Eight Tips for Successfully Closing a Short Sale
If you are considering the purchase or sale of a short sale property, the following eight tips will help ensure a smooth and stress-free closing process:
1. Engage a Short Sale Specialist
It is essential to hire an agent who is specifically certified in handling short sales, as not all agents possess this expertise. A specialist can effectively manage communication with lenders and expedite the approval process.
2. Obtain Pre-Approval as a Buyer
If you are in the market for short sale properties, it is advisable to secure financing in advance. This demonstrates to the lender your commitment and seriousness as a buyer.
3. Prepare a Comprehensive Short Sale Package
As a seller, it is important to organize essential documents such as tax returns, pay stubs, hardship letters, and bank statements. This will help prevent any unnecessary delays in the process.
4. Understand the Property’s True Value
To support the sale price to the lender, it is prudent to obtain a Broker Price Opinion or appraisal early in the process. This will provide a clear justification for the proposed price.
5. Maintain Clear Communication with All Parties
Short sales typically involve multiple stakeholders, including the seller, buyer, lender, title company, and occasionally investors. Keeping all parties informed throughout the process is crucial for ensuring a successful transaction.
6. Exercise Patience with the Timeline
Short sales often require more time to complete compared to traditional transactions. It is advisable to establish clear expectations from the outset to avoid any unforeseen circumstances.
7. Engage in Negotiations for Repairs or Credits When Feasible
While many buyers may overlook this aspect, employing a strategic approach can enable you to obtain necessary concessions.
8. Proactively Address Title and Lien Checks
Resolve any outstanding tax liens, homeowners association fees, or second mortgages early in the process to prevent any obstructions at closing.
By adhering to these guidelines, your short sale real estate transaction is likely to conclude more swiftly and with fewer unexpected issues.
